Seroatlas reads FAM246B as an antibody target. Whether an autoantibody or antibody against FAM246B could matter depends on whether native FAM246B is physically reachable, whether the body needs it intact, and whether it acts in a disease-relevant tissue.
FAM246B is annotated as predominantly intracellular. Intracellular proteins are common autoantibody markers, becoming visible to the immune system after cell injury or altered processing, but are usually markers of disease rather than direct drivers.
